HuskerfaninOkieland Posted September 14, 2007 Share Posted September 14, 2007 Air Force flyboy here and the T-38 would be a pretty weak flyover. -16's or 15's (from the AF) or -18's from the Navy would be much better. The T-38 is nothing but a trainer now. It's similar to the F-5 (Russian plane in Top Gun) with the difference being the -38 is a 2 seater, the -5 is a single seater. I was able to get a ride in a -38 years ago and it is a fun little airplane but not nearly as fun as the B-1 ride I got. T-38 F-5 Quote Link to comment
